The search query is surprisingly popular among students, researchers, and IT professionals. Why? Because SymbolMTNormal is not a decorative or stylistic font; it is a utility. It is the silent workhorse behind mathematical notations, Greek symbols, and specialized technical characters.

SymbolMTNormal is a TrueType font (TTF) developed by Microsoft and Monotype Imaging. The "MT" in its name stands for , a renowned typesetting company. The font is essentially an extended version of the classic "Symbol" font that has been part of Windows since the early 1990s.

However, the search for persists because of the massive backlog of documents created between 1995 and 2010. Universities, law firms, and manufacturing companies still have thousands of critical files that reference this specific font.
